Coal Deposits
Coal Deposits are accumulations of coal found in the Earth’s crust, originating from the decayed plant material under high pressure and heat over millions of years, primarily used as a fossil fuel.
Uranium Deposits
Concentrations of uranium minerals within the earth's crust, typically exploitable for nuclear fuel.
Hydrothermal System
A circulation system where hot water and steam are produced by the heat from magma or the Earth's hot interior, often found near volcanic areas.
Energy Resource
Any natural or artificial source of energy that can be converted into another form of energy, such as heat or electricity, to be used for power.
